In addition to Kuka, there is another company that Mo Hui is highly concerned about, this company is called Kaben, which is a start-up company, and their products have not even taken shape.

Kaben is also a robot, but it is completely opposite to Kuka, it is mainly a home robot, or to be more precise, it is a housekeeping robot.

Although a housekeeping robot sounds very low-end, in fact, it needs to solve more technical difficulties, and the scenarios it needs to face are more complex, which may be more difficult than industrial robots.

This is easy to relevant, industrial robots are facing fixed scenes, are set scenes, they usually work on the assembly line, the working scenes are carefully designed, what parts to process, what actions, the connection between the various actions, etc., are basically easy to standardize and standardize.

However, for housekeeping robots, although the scene is an indoor home scene, there are many variables and non-standardized events that will be encountered.

For example, sweeping the floor, if there is a melon seed skin on the ground to sweep away, but if there is a signature pen, whether it needs to be picked up, and how to store it is also a problem; If there is an apple, do you need to judge whether it is a rotten apple or a good apple, whether it is an apple that has been bitten and discarded, or an intact apple? What if you come across a cat sleeping on the ground? What if a puppy came running over and peed on the robot's leg?

There will be a lot of problems like this, and these are the problems that Carbon will face and solve, and if these problems are not solved well, their products will not be able to take shape and be commercialized.

If the main difficulty of industrial robots is in precision, multi-role interchange, then the difficulty of housekeeping robots is in intelligence, according to the current robot technology, the robotic arm of housekeeping robots is no longer a difficulty, and even automatic walking, maintaining balance, visual recognition, etc. are not obstacles, the core is how to combine these functions to play a role, so that the robot can flexibly deal with all kinds of problems encountered in home scenes.
